As I mentioned it's backwards compatible and runs under DX11 mode but with the exclusive functions disabled which is the displacement shader effect (It's not tesselation, only affects the surface textures.) contact hardened shadows (Softened edges for them.) and the additional lighting pass (Far more refined bloom and glow effects on objects, demanding though.)

Also in that post a bit up 267.24 isn't the newest driver and NVIDIA has performance issues with the game supposedly improved in the later (Was it .30 something or .50 something 267?) drivers though more updates are planned.

INI was something I posted back for the demo and every single setting carried over along with all explanations but here's what I use.

 Spoiler:
 


The GraphicsDetailLevel=3 defaults to 2 unless it's write protected but everything else will work, for audio problems try enforcing stereo output instead in the audio options.
(GraphicsDetailLevel=2 is just fine, high and v.high are identical minus the DX11 specific options.)

I'm playing at nightmare and it's quite a effort to bring down teams of AI troops without pausing and planning ahead, Varric the dumb-ass usually runs around when someone gets near so I've accidentally aggroed way too many troops one more than one occasion and the AI improvements are pretty nice.
(As said though enemy health is way increased on that level and they use potions and abilities like crazy, rogues are lethal due to their stun/knockback stuff and backstab.)

EDIT: Materials and the new item level (star) is pretty confusing at first, you can have this nice Aurum (tier 9 in DA:O) longsword but only one star so when you get a two-star axe at red steel (tier 5 in DA:O) it can be far better, similarly one-handed high-star gear beats high-material two-handed items easily so it's a bit confusing, nice armors and all as well but the re-used weapon models (And they use the high-quality unique ones a lot now.) are a bit funny to see as common near-junk grade.
